Not the first time someone has reported this behavior. Sounds like you need to take a trip to the dealership after talking to them.

If you Maverick was built before the middle of May 2022, you may be eligible for a customer satisfaction program that might have something to do with this. Go to the Ford Canada website, just search for recall by VIN Ford Canada, and put your VIN in to find out.
